00:00The boastful wrestler
00:01Once, a tall, handsome, well-built wrestler visited a king's royal court.
00:17He said to the king,
00:19Your Majesty, I am very healthy and my body is full of strength.
00:25I can drink hundred liters of milk a day.
00:29I can fight ten wrestlers at one go, single-handedly.
00:35I had once lifted a mountain on my head and my fights with lions are well known.
00:42The king heard all the wrestler's tales and seeing him, he was impressed.
00:48He gave the wrestler a post to work on.
00:52The king was sure that someday his services would be needed.
00:56The wrestler did not do much.
01:00Mostly, he used to tell his boastful tales and used to eat a lot, sleep a lot and impress the king with false tales.
01:10There was a high hill near the kingdom's border.
01:14It so happened that wild animals from the forests on the hill slopes started entering the villages at night.
01:23They used to spoil the standing crops and often attack poultry and cattle for food.
01:29This news reached the king's ears.
01:32You had once claimed that you had lifted a mountain on your head.
01:38Now is the time to prove yourself.
01:41There is a forested hill near our kingdom's border.
01:45You must lift it and shift or throw it somewhere far from us.
01:51This way, my people will no longer be troubled by the animals from these forests.
01:58Yes, your majesty, we'll go there immediately.
02:02But before that, I want to eat something.
02:06So, he had a heavy lunch and then accompanied the king and the courtiers to where the hill stood.
02:14I am ready to lift the hill.
02:17Your majesty, tell me, should I throw it into the next kingdom or to the country across the sea?
02:24I can do as you wish.
02:26But first, you'll have to call your men so that they dig the hill out of the firm ground before I lift it on my head.
02:37The wrestler was of no use at all.
02:40Moral
02:44False claims get you nowhere.
